Invention Grant
- Patent Title: Method and system for implementing language neutral virtual assistant
-
Application No.: US16664928Application Date: 2019-10-27
-
Publication No.: US11475875B2Publication Date: 2022-10-18
- Inventor: Sriram Chakravarthy , Madhav Vodnala , Balakota Srinivas Vinnakota , Ram Menon
- Applicant: Sriram Chakravarthy , Madhav Vodnala , Balakota Srinivas Vinnakota , Ram Menon
- Applicant Address: US CA Saratoga; US CA San Jose; US CA Sunnyvale; US CA Los Altos
- Assignee: Sriram Chakravarthy,Madhav Vodnala,Balakota Srinivas Vinnakota,Ram Menon
- Current Assignee: Sriram Chakravarthy,Madhav Vodnala,Balakota Srinivas Vinnakota,Ram Menon
- Current Assignee Address: US CA Saratoga; US CA San Jose; US CA Sunnyvale; US CA Los Altos
- Main IPC: G06F40/58
- IPC: G06F40/58 ; G10L15/22 ; G10L15/00 ; G06F40/47 ; G10L15/30

Abstract:
In one aspect, a computerized method useful for implementing a language neutral virtual assistant including the step of providing a language detector. The language detector comprises one or more trained language classifiers. With language detector identifying a language of an incoming message from a user to an artificially intelligent (AI) personal assistant. The method includes the step of receiving an incoming message to the AI personal assistant. The method includes the step of normalizing the incoming message, wherein the normalizing the incoming message comprises a set of spelling corrections and a set of grammar corrections. The method includes the step of translating the incoming message to a specified language with a specified encoding process and a specified decoding process. The method includes the step of providing an AI personal assistant engine that comprise an artificial intelligence which conducts a conversation via auditory or textual methods. The AI personal assistant engine provides outputs a response translator. The method includes the step of providing a response translator that uses the AI personal assistant engine output to provide a response to the user.
Information query